The role:
As a Lead AV Specialist, you will be responsible for designing, implementing, and maintaining cutting-edge audiovisual (AV) solutions across our offices and event spaces. You’ll lead a team of AV professionals, ensuring seamless execution of live events, high-impact meetings, and executive communications. Your expertise will drive innovation, scalability, and world-class AV experiences globally across SoFi Technologies.
What you'll do:
- AV Infrastructure & Systems: Design, deploy, and maintain AV systems, including conferencing platforms, digital signage, and collaboration tools.
- Event Support: Oversee AV operations for high-profile events, executive meetings, and live streams, ensuring flawless delivery.
- Technical Leadership: Lead and mentor a team of AV technicians, providing training and best practices for troubleshooting and support.
- Collaboration & Innovation: Partner with IT, Facilities, and Workplace Experience teams to enhance AV capabilities and user experience.
- Vendor Management: Work with AV service providers, integrators, and hardware vendors to ensure high-quality installations and support.
- Problem-Solving & Optimization: Analyze performance data, troubleshoot issues, and implement solutions to improve system reliability and efficiency.
What you’ll need:
- 8+ years of experience in the AV/VC industry
- Proven experience in coordinating the installation of large-scale AV setups.
- Exceptional organizational skills with a keen focus on customer service.
- Expertise in installing, operating, and troubleshooting Polycom and Zoom video-teleconferencing systems.
- Strong design skills for room layouts, schematics, and wiring diagrams.
- Must be comfortable working in a fast-paced, demanding environment. The pace requires independent and confident thinking, self-motivation and determination
- Experience in configuring and troubleshooting various Audio Video hardware.
- Good organization and time management skills with a proven ability to manage multiple priorities
- Ability to oversee AV events and ensure a superior experience for participants.

What you need to know about the Seattle Tech Scene
Key Facts About Seattle Tech
- Number of Tech Workers: 287,000; 13%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
- Major Tech Employers: Amazon, Microsoft, Meta, Google
-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, software, biotechnology, game development
-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
- Notable Investors: Madrona, Fuse, Tola, Maveron
- Research Centers and Universities: University of Washington, Seattle University, Seattle Pacific University, Allen Institute for Brain Science,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ation, Seattle Children’s Research Institute
